WHAT TO DO WHEN YOU ARE CONFRONTED
(A Good Follow-Up on Resolving Conflict)


Five Rules to Follow:

 

1. Don’t Get Defensive

We tend to defend ourselves.

 

2. Thank the Person For Coming Directly To You

Yes, thank them! They could have complained to others instead of
coming to you.

 

3. Listen and Do Not Interrupt

Focus on hearing what they have to say versus considering what you will say.

 

4. Apologize If You Are Wrong

Own it and be sincere in asking forgiveness.

 

5. If You Disagree:

A. Thank them and stay humble.
B. Process what they have shared.
C. Embrace the 2%.

 

 

WHY IS IT IMPORTANT TO FOLLOW THESE RULES?

If you are not approachable and people do not come to you, it will:

• Create blind spots for you
• Limit your growth
• Compromise relationships

 

View being confronted as a gift, not as an attack.
